To reach a balanced portfolio, alternative investments emerged in prominence among institutional and private traders striving to enhance returns and lower asset mix correlation with standard markets. These investments encompass a broad array of opportunities, including private equity, hedge funds, property investment trusts, goods, valuable metals, and lately, digital assets and cryptocurrency investments. Private equity holdings yield potential access to corporations not accessible through public markets, commonly with longer investment timelines and potentially greater returns exchanged for limited liquidity. Real estate securities, whether through direct property ownership or REITs, can offer price escalation protection and consistent revenue streams as providing portfolio variety gains. Product investments, such as valuables like gold and silver, farming items, and power resources, can serve as inflation protection and confer returns that frequently adjust independently from shares and bond markets. However, these non-traditional assets frequently require a greater expertise and may include increased expenses, reduced liquidity, and different fiscal effects in comparison to regular assets. Comprehending the varied asset classes open to investors composes the basis of effective profile administration in today's economic markets. Standard categories consist of equities, bonds, commodities, and property, each offering distinct risk-return profiles that serve varied aims within a comprehensive financial investment strategy. Equities typically provide growth potential over extended time horizons, while bonds offer a more steady income streams and capital safeguarding benefits. Commodities can function as inflation hedges, and real estate holdings routinely offer both revenue generation and potential value increase. The key to successful investing rests on comprehending how these various classifications behave under changing market conditions and economic cycles. Veteran traders realize that each asset type responds distinctly to factors such as rate of interest changes, price increases, geopolitical events, and economic growth waves. Fixed income investments and investment planning deliver crucial stability and earnings generation within well-designed holdings, providing predictable returns and serving as a counterbalance to greater unstable equity holdings. State bonds, particularly those provided by secure nations, traditionally function as refuge possessions during times of market turbulence, while commercial bonds can offer greater returns, requiring assent of supplementary here debt hazard. The fixed income landscape has expanded considerably, currently featuring cost increase shielded securities, local bonds for tax advantaged income, and worldwide bonds that provide currency diversification gains. Time frame hazard sensibility, credit exposure, and interest rate reactivity are crucial facets when selecting proper fixed income holdings for different portfolio objectives and economic environments. Several savvy traders additionally consider bond laddering methods, where securities with various expiration periods are purchased to provide routine revenue while managing reinvestment hazard.
